Falling behind on Preventative Maintenance:  When you’re constantly adapting to new circumstances, everyday maintenance tends to fall by the wayside. But that’s precisely when it is needed most! Failure to regularly clean, lube and exchange worn parts can escalate a minor breakdown to a total catastrophe. Consider boosting your PM plan with performance monitoring technology. By combining line counter data with hands-on technician experience, you’ll get the clearest insight to predict wear and tear issues. Overspending on Packaging Supplies: Disposables like stretch film, tape, corrugated and Void fill are called such because they are intended to be used once and thrown away. When you spend more than you need on single-use materials, you are essentially just throwing your money away! This happens when case tapers require more than one pass, when stretch film is so thin that it requires additional wraps, or when your cases are thicker than necessary for your application. Utilize right-size packaging solutions: One of the most effective ways to save space, reduce costs, and support eco-objectives is by utilizing right-size packaging. Often, businesses default to using standard-sized boxes or containers, leading to wasted space and the need for extra filler materials.
